What is the Trainer's Facility Use Agreement?
The Trainer's Facility Use Agreement is a pivotal legal document that defines the relationship and expectations between a trainer and a stable. It holds legal significance as it outlines the responsibilities and rights of both parties, ensuring adherence to the agreed terms. Within this framework, the trainer is granted access to use the stable's facilities for horse training and related equestrian activities, while the stable retains ownership and management of the property. Proper documentation, including this agreement, is crucial in equestrian activities to mitigate risks and protect both trainers and stables.
Purpose and Benefits of the Trainer's Facility Use Agreement
This agreement serves multiple objectives for trainers and stables, primarily providing a structured environment for operations. Key benefits include:
-
Liability protection for trainers and stables in case of accidents.
-
Establishing clear revenue sharing arrangements to avoid misunderstandings.
-
Minimizing risks associated with equine activities through defined terms and conditions.
By outlining these critical aspects, the Trainer's Facility Use Agreement promotes a safer and more efficient training process for all involved.
Key Features of the Trainer's Facility Use Agreement
The Trainer's Facility Use Agreement encompasses several essential elements, including:
-
Terms of use for the facilities and equipment.
-
Insurance requirements covering accidents and incidents.
-
Liability waivers that protect both parties from claims related to horse training risks.
-
Customizable sections for easy adaptation to specific situations, including dates, names, percentages, and signature lines.
These features are critical for ensuring clear expectations and legal compliance in the equestrian environment.

Who needs to sign the Trainer's Facility Use Agreement?
Both the Trainer and the Stable owner are required to sign the Trainer's Facility Use Agreement to ensure that both parties agree to the terms stated within the document.
Is notarization required for this agreement?
The Trainer's Facility Use Agreement does not require notarization, making it easier and quicker for both parties to finalize the document.
What are the key terms covered in this agreement?
The agreement outlines usage terms, revenue sharing, insurance requirements, liability waivers, and the inherent risks associated with equine activities, ensuring clarity for both parties.
Can this agreement be modified after signing?
Yes, while modifications are possible, any changes should ideally be documented in writing and require mutual consent to avoid disputes later.
What types of information should I have before filling out the form?
Before completing the form, gather essential information such as the names of the Trainer and Stable, training schedules, insurance details, and agreements on revenue sharing percentages.
